New Skyrme interaction for normal and exotic nuclei

A new set of Skyrme parameters is obtained from a fit to the binding energies, rms charge radii, and single-particle energies of both normal and exotic spherical nuclei. Nuclear matter and neutron matter properties are used to put constraints on the parameters which are not well determined from the nuclear data. Special problems with the Nolen-Schiffer anomaly and the spin-orbit interaction are discussed.
